The Effect of Heat Shock on the Expression of Urokinase-type Plasminogen Activator in Human Tongue Squamous Cell Carcinoma Cell Line (Tca8113)

Abstract:

Objective The aim of this studywas to observe the expression of urokinase-type plasminogen activator (UPA) in human tongue squamous cell carcinoma cell line (Tca8113) after heat shockwith different dosage.Methods The expression of UPA protein ofTca8113 after different heating temperatures(37℃、40℃、43℃and 45℃) treatmentwas examined by immuno- histochemical technique (IH) and flow cytometry (FCM).Results Compared with 37℃group, the UPA protein expression in 40℃and 43℃groups decreased significantly (P<0·05); however, the UPA protein expression in 45℃group decreased but no statistical difference was found.Conclusion Hyperthermia could inhibit invasion and metastasis of oral squamous cell carcino- ma and could be considered as a safe method in curing the tumor.
